Как организованы серверные операционные системы
Как организованы серверные операционные системы
Серверные операционные системы представляют собой профильное программное обеспечение для администрирования аппаратурными ресурсами компьютера. Конструкция таких систем основывается на основе многозадачности и многопользовательского доступа. Ядро согласует функционирование процессора, оперативной памяти, дисковых носителей и сетевых интерфейсов.
Основу формирует модульная структура, где каждый элемент исполняет установленные функции. Драйверы обеспечивают связь с материальным устройствами. Планировщик задач делит вычислительные мощности между задачами. Файловая система структурирует сохранение сведений на дисках.
Серверная вавада содержит службы для обработки сетевых обращений и старта сервисов. Системные библиотеки предоставляют программам подготовленные процедуры для операций с возможностями. Средства обособления задач исключают конфликты между приложениями.
Интерфейс командной строки позволяет управляющим конфигурировать установки и мониторить состояние системы. Логи событий регистрируют данные о деятельности компонентов vavada. Такая архитектура предоставляет бесперебойную деятельность устройств под значительной нагруженностью.
Чем серверная ОС отличается от обычной
Ключевое расхождение заключается в назначении и методе эксплуатации. Настольные системы нацелены на работу одного оператора с оконными программами. Серверные платформы обрабатывают множество одновременных коннектов и исполняют фоновые операции без вмешательства человека.
Графический интерфейс в серверных модификациях часто недоступен или минимизирован. Администрирование осуществляется через командную строку и конфигурационные файлы. Такой подход уменьшает потребление ресурсов и поднимает производительность. Настольные варианты обеспечивают оконные инструменты для ежедневных задач.
Серверные решения поддерживают продвинутые функции роста. Решения vavada работают с крупными количествами памяти и набором процессорных cores. Стабильность и бесперебойность деятельности критически существенны для серверного программного обеспечения. Системы конструируются для круглосуточного действия без перезагрузок. Системы копирования оберегают от ошибок. Настольные варианты допускают систематические перезагрузки и менее чувствительны к отказоустойчивости.
Главные функции серверных систем
Серверные системы решают совокупность целей по предоставлению деятельности сетевых сервисов и программ:
- Выполнение поступающих сетевых соединений и перенаправление трафика.
- Активация и надзор функционирования прикладных утилит и веб-сервисов.
- Разделение процессорной ресурсов между запущенными потоками.
- Контроль состояния технических блоков и программных элементов.
- Ведение записей событий для оценки производительности.
Программное обеспечение согласует связь между клиентными терминалами и процессорными ресурсами. Организация обеспечивает синхронно осуществлять тысячи запросов от множественных операторов.
Размещение и контроль информацией представляет ключевую функцию серверных систем. Файловые системы структурируют обращение к материалам, медиафайлам и архивам. Системы управления базами данных осуществляют систематизированную сведения. Системы резервного копирования ограждают важные данные от потери.
Платформа гарантирует обособление клиентских контекстов и приложений. Виртуализация обеспечивает активировать ряд независимых казино вавада на одном материальном сервере. Выравнивание загрузки выделяет задания между свободными ресурсами для наилучшей скорости.
Как обрабатываются запросы операторов
Процесс выполнения инициируется с получения запроса через сетевой интерфейс. Поступающее соединение направляется в очередь, где дожидается своей очереди. Сетевой уровень исследует фрагменты сведений и устанавливает целевой модуль. Диспетчер отправляет обращение релевантному софтверному компоненту.
Программа извлекает сведения и осуществляет нужные процедуры. Программа может запросить к файловой системе для чтения или сохранения данных. База данных предоставляет затребованные данные. Расчетные операции осуществляются процессором согласно первоочередности операции.
Многопоточная конструкция позволяет обрабатывать совокупность обращений параллельно. Каждое подключение приобретает индивидуальный поток исполнения. Планировщик разносит CPU время между активными задачами. Серверная вавада проверяет расход памяти и исключает переполнение ресурсов.
Сгенерированный ответ высылается обратно заказчику через сетевое канал. Протоколы транспортного слоя обеспечивают доставку сведений. Журнал записывает данные о исполненной действии и положении выполнения. Очищенные ресурсы делаются доступными для новых запросов.
Управление возможностями и загрузкой
Грамотное деление ресурсов обеспечивает надежную работу всех модулей. Планировщик операций назначает приоритеты процессов и выделяет CPU время. Алгоритмы распределения предотвращают избыточную нагрузку конкретных компонентов. Контроль отслеживает текущее статус аппаратуры в настоящем режиме.
Оперативная память распределяется между выполняющимися процессами гибко. Средство виртуализации задействует накопительное объем при недостатке аппаратной памяти. Кэширование повышает подключение к регулярно запрашиваемым информации. Автоматическая сборка освобождает незадействованные участки памяти.
Дисковые операции ускоряются через очереди запросов и упреждающее считывание. Файловая система кластеризует связанные информацию для уменьшения времени подключения. Серверные vavada допускают оперативную замену хранилищ без приостановки деятельности.
Сетевая модуль регулирует пропускную способность путей коммуникации. Регулирование темпа предотвращает узурпацию bandwidth индивидуальными подключениями. Ранжирование данных обеспечивает стандарт обслуживания важных служб. Метрики загрузки содействует организовывать рост системы.
Безопасность и регулирование входа
Защита информации и средств основывается на многоуровневой структуре разграничения полномочий. Каждый оператор приобретает уникальный ID и комплект разрешений. Аутентификация проверяет достоверность регистрационных профилей при подключении. Пароли содержатся в криптованном состоянии для пресечения незаконного подключения.
Права доступа к документам и каталогам устанавливаются персонально для каждого элемента. Собственник объекта определяет допустимые операции для остальных операторов. Объединения консолидируют пользовательские аккаунты с равными правами. Серверная казино вавада останавливает старания реализации запрещенных манипуляций.
Firewall экран фильтрует приходящий и исходящий поток по определенным критериям. Реестры доступа сужают коннекты с указанных IP-адресов. Системы детектирования взломов анализируют подозрительную поведение. Шифрование защищает транспортируемую информацию от перехвата.
Протоколы безопасности сохраняют все попытки подключения к ограниченным ресурсам. Проверка событий помогает выявить отклонения регламента. Самостоятельные алерты уведомляют управляющих о опасных случаях. Периодическое обновление параметров подстраивает систему к современным угрозам.
Деятельность с сетью и подключениями
Сетевая модуль гарантирует взаимодействие сервера с сторонними устройствами и другими машинами. Сетевые адаптеры принимают и транслируют данные по разным стандартам. Драйверы карт управляют аппаратными интерфейсами. Установка IP-адресов устанавливает распознавание узла в сети.
Стек протоколов TCP/IP осуществляет пересылку данных на множественных уровнях. Перенаправление направляет фрагменты к целевым узлам через эффективные направления. DNS-резолвер преобразует доменные обозначения в numeric адреса. DHCP автоматически выделяет сетевые настройки подсоединенным устройствам.
Контроль коннектами объединяет надзор работающих сессий и таймаутов. Резервы соединений многократно задействуют созданные каналы для оптимизации ресурсов. Серверные вавада обеспечивают тысячи одновременных TCP-соединений благодаря эффективным алгоритмам. Балансировщики делят поступающий поток между несколькими машинами.
Мониторинг сетевой активности отслеживает пропускную способность и задержки. Проверочные инструменты проверяют связность внешних узлов. Аналитика адаптеров выдает величины пересланных данных и число сбоев. Настройка очередей увеличивает производительность при множественных категориях нагрузки.
Апдейты и поддержка решения
Регулярное обновление программного обеспечения гарантирует защищенность и бесперебойность деятельности. Создатели издают обновления для ликвидации дыр и ошибок. Системы пакетов автоматизируют получение и установку патчей. Управляющие планируют внедрение изменений в промежутки низкой нагруженности.
Проверка патчей на отдельных средах исключает непредвиденные неполадки. Резервное копирование параметров обеспечивает моментально отменить модификации при трудностях. Серверная vavada обеспечивает функции отката к предыдущим редакциям блоков.
Контроль состояния фиксирует присутствие современных редакций программ и библиотек. Оповещения извещают о критических обновлениях охраны. Автоматизированные проверки выявляют неактуальные блоки. Стратегии обновления задают первоочередности и временные рамки внедрения изменений.
Техническая поддержка создателей обеспечивает рекомендации по настройке и решению неисправностей. Коммьюнити пользователей распространяет опытом решения заданий. Хранилища информации хранят мануалы по конфигурированию. Коммерческие соглашения гарантируют предоставление патчей в продолжение заданного времени.
Где применяются серверные операционные системы
Веб-хостинг является одну из ключевых сфер эксплуатации серверных систем. Фирмы хостят ресурсы и веб-приложения на dedicated или виртуальных серверах. Системы обрабатывают HTTP-запросы от миллионов юзеров каждодневно.
Корпоративные сети базируются на серверную базу для размещения информации и запуска бизнес-приложений. Файловые серверы предоставляют консолидированный обращение к файлам. Почтовые платформы выполняют сообщения предприятия. Базы данных включают информацию о потребителях и бухгалтерских процедурах.
Облачные провайдеры создают гибкие решения на базе серверных платформ. Виртуализация обеспечивает создавать обособленные среды для разных клиентов. Серверные казино вавада обеспечивают адаптивность и производительность облачных служб.
Исследовательские расчеты запрашивают высокопроизводительных серверных систем для выполнения огромных количеств сведений. Научные институты эмулируют трудные процессы. Медицинские организации размещают компьютерные досье пациентов на охраняемых узлах. Учебные платформы обеспечивают обращение к учебным данным.
